Not enough evidence to explain circumstances of Noah Donohoe’s death, partly due to police mistakes, inquest finds An inquest into the death of a teenager whose body was found in a Belfast storm drain has found there is not enough evidence to explain the puzzling circumstances of how he died, partly because of mistakes by police investigators.
Noah Donohoe, 14, was last seen on 21 June 2020 when he left his south Belfast home on…
